MINING PLAN <br /> Exhibit C <br /> The purpose of taking the step up to Exploration Phase was because the Claim is used for public digging. <br /> It is a fee digging area. That is the reason for this upgrade. <br /> This will give me the ability to manage the claim better and explore. The digging for the public will be <br /> with hand tools. Mechanical machinery will be used to groom the area and make Exploration trenches. <br /> The trenches will be 3 to 4 feet in depth and no deeper for safety reasons. Due to the problems of <br /> keeping the public in the areas to dig I plan on enlarging the area to 4.4 acres next year. This has been <br /> reflected in the State of Colorado's(this) paperwork. I will upgrade the BLM's paperwork next app. <br /> period. <br /> The barite being mined is not of high value. The lure is people can go somewhere and explore and <br /> find mineral specimens of moderate value.This makes Hartsel a destination not just a drive through <br /> town. Kids and parents have good family time together. <br /> BLM has acknowledged the old mining trenches from the past. That is the reason top soil is not present. <br /> 13. a I will mine when frost leaves the ground in the spring until I freezes in the fall. <br /> 13. b I have included the plan I submitted to BLM. BLM acknowledges previous strip and trench <br /> mining. Therefore the loss of the top soil.
